Serhiy Storchaka added the comment: Actually it should be:
# Using zlib's interface while not d.eof: output = d.decompress(d.unconsumed_tail, 8192) while not output and not d.eof: compressed = f.read(8192) if not compressed: raise ValueError('End-of-stream marker not found') output = d.decompress(d.unconsumed_tail + compressed, 8192) # <process output> Note that you should use d.unconsumed_tail + compressed as input, and therefore do an unnecessary copy of the data.
